쉘 스크립트를 만든는데요???????

0huni의 이미지

...
file=$(date +%Y%m%d)_backup  
echo $file
...

위와같이 하면 "오늘날짜_backup"이 되잖아요?
예를 들어 20041206_backup 처럼...

그런데 오늘의 하루전을 나타내고 싶은데 어떻게 하면 되는건가요?
"20041206_backup" 이 아닌 "20041205_backup " 이렇게요..

방법 좀 가르쳐주세요~~~

익명 사용자의 이미지

0huni wrote:
...
file=$(date +%Y%m%d)_backup  
echo $file
...

위와같이 하면 "오늘날짜_backup"이 되잖아요?
예를 들어 20041206_backup 처럼...

그런데 오늘의 하루전을 나타내고 싶은데 어떻게 하면 되는건가요?
"20041206_backup" 이 아닌 "20041205_backup " 이렇게요..

방법 좀 가르쳐주세요~~~


echo file=$(date +%Y%m%d --date="yesterday")_backup
antz의 이미지

0huni wrote:
그런데 오늘의 하루전을 나타내고 싶은데 어떻게 하면 되는건가요?
"20041206_backup" 이 아닌 "20041205_backup " 이렇게요..

한글 man page에 해당 내용 있습니다.

Quote:
이틀 전의 날짜를 출력하기 위해서

date --date '2 days ago'

date +%Y%m%d --date '1 days ago'

0huni의 이미지

이상하네...ㅠ.ㅠ

그대로 카피해서 터미널에 paste하니까 그냥 오늘 날짜만 보입니다.
왜 이런건가요?

antz의 이미지

0huni wrote:
이상하네...ㅠ.ㅠ

그대로 카피해서 터미널에 paste하니까 그냥 오늘 날짜만 보입니다.
왜 이런건가요?


글쎄요... 안된다니... 안되는 이유는 잘 모르겠고,
제가 시스템에서 테스트 한것을 보여 드리겠습니다.
Quote:

dhjang@linuxbox:~
04:58 오후 $ date
2004. 12. 06. (월) 16:59:50 KST

dhjang@linuxbox:~
04:59 오후 $ date +%Y%m%d --date '1 days ago'
20041205

dhjang@linuxbox:~
04:59 오후 $ date --date '1 days ago'
2004. 12. 05. (일) 17:00:06 KST

dhjang@linuxbox:~
05:00 오후 $ date --version
date (coreutils) 5.2.1
Written by David MacKenzie.

Copyright (C) 2004 Free Software Foundation, Inc.
This is free software; see the source for copying conditions. There is NO
war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.

dhjang@linuxbox:~
05:00 오후 $

koddakgi의 이미지

여기 게시판에 올라왔던건데.....
env TZ=KST+15 date

여자는 도대체 무엇으로 사는가?

댓글 달기

Filtered HTML

  • 텍스트에 BBCode 태그를 사용할 수 있습니다. URL은 자동으로 링크 됩니다.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>
  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.

BBCode

  • 텍스트에 BBCode 태그를 사용할 수 있습니다. URL은 자동으로 링크 됩니다.
  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param>
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.

Textile

  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• You can use Textile markup to format text.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>

Markdown

  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• Quick Tips:
    • Two or more spaces at a line's end = Line break
    • Double returns = Paragraph
    • *Single asterisks* or _single underscores_ = Emphasis
    • **Double** or __double__ = Strong
    • This is [a link](http://the.link.example.com "The optional title text")
    For complete details on the Markdown syntax, see the Markdown documentation and Markdown Extra documentation for tables, footnotes, and more.
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>

Plain text

  • HTML 태그를 사용할 수 없습니다.
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.
  • 줄과 단락은 자동으로 분리됩니다.
댓글 첨부 파일
이 댓글에 이미지나 파일을 업로드 합니다.
파일 크기는 8 MB보다 작아야 합니다.
허용할 파일 형식: txt pdf doc xls gif jpg jpeg mp3 png rar zip.
CAPTCHA
이것은 자동으로 스팸을 올리는 것을 막기 위해서 제공됩니다.